Oregon Coast Humane Society
Non-profit, no-kill animal shelter
The purpose of the Corporation shall be: to rescue, care for, and find responsible, loving homes for homeless and "at-risk" dogs and cats; to advance the goal of a no-kill community; to promote the principle of a lifetime commitment to our pets; and to promote spay/neuter
and educational programs to the public.
The Oregon Coast Humane Society, located in Florence, Oregon, is a limited intake, no-kill shelter serving the animal welfare needs in Western Lane County. Comprised of volunteers and a committed professional staff, we are dedicated to assisting homeless or abused companion animals in our area. We also seek to educate people about animal-related issues such as cruelty and pet overpopulation.
